The Aussie Rules season reaches round six this weekend with league leaders West Coast Eagles going up against seventh placed North Melbourne.

Other key matches this weekend see second placed Sydney Swans playing host to Adelaide, while the Essendon Bombers will look to move back into third spot with a win over the Brisbane Lions.
